Ladoga, IN, United States, North America, Earth | Just to make sure, you have updated your Seedstar system on that planter to Seedstar2 correct? The original Seedstar is a 4/5 CAN system. Assuming that you have updated your planter to the right Seedstar version, there will be a square CAN connector on the harness that you will be able to tie the rate controller into. That will give you a rate controller on the planter and then you can wire the one up in the cab. | ||

Ladoga, IN, United States, North America, Earth | Seedstar Gen 2 didn't start until 2004. All 1770NT CCS and 1790 planters are Seedstar Gen 2. There was a CAN Fold option, which I believe is what he has that would have used the display to fold. If he didn't have the CAN fold option all of them would have a seperate fold box. | ||

Ladoga, IN, United States, North America, Earth | What you will need is a PF90553 harness. Since you already have an ISO harness ran, you should be able to find a Round CAN connection near the center of the planter with a terminator plugged into it. The PF90553 will have a Round to Square CAN adapter that will allow you to hook the rate controller in by removing the terminator connection and plugging the round CAN plug in. Run the 3 pin grey connector up to the tractor and plug the PF90550 harness into it to get your footswitch and constant power to the rate controller. And if I remember right you will find a 2 pin weatherpak connection to break apart and plug this harness into that connection to get your high current power. Weatherford, OK | I have a 1770 with CAN fold and I put a rate controller on it and tied it into the CAN on the planter and then when I powered everything up I lost the planter and could not get it back. Even had AMS guy come out and he told me that the CAN frame control was not compatible with the rate controller that is why there is no more CAN frame control. So I updated mine to normal frame control via AG express and put seedstar2 on the planter. I figure if I had to buy a wedge box I wanted a new one. Deere says that you have to put a new harness in, but I just rewired the old one. I would say you have to get rid of the frame control or run a separate can and desplay for the planter and rate controller. Edited by Farmerjh 1/25/2012 23:52 | ||
